Title: The Child's Story-Book
Description: New York, Kiggins & Kellogg, 1856. Paperback. 48mo (3 5/8" X 2¼"). Stiff green pictorial wrappers. 16pp. Several steel engravings. Very good. Mildly edgeworn, with tight text block lightly age toned. Attractive early copy of the fourth title in this publisher's "Second Series." Front wrapper address ("123 & 125 William St.") differing from title page address ("88 John Street") makes this a transitional printing, likely 1856. Kiggins & Kellogg (founded 1847) published four of these juvenile series, each consistin of 12 of these tiny booklets -- most of which, given their size and usage, are rather scarce in nice condition. This episode consists of six syrupy two-page tales ("The Stag-Hunt," The Cat," "The Little Ship," "The Beggar," "The Robin," The White Rabbit" ) closing with a two-stanza poem "Little Mary." A charming survivor in quite handleable condition. .
